This project analyzes gender representation in British and American film adaptations of 19th-century women's novels. It examines how these adaptations influence perceptions of women's roles and agency in historical contexts, utilizing interdisciplinary approaches from adaptation and gender studies.
The aim of the project is to analyse the gender aspects of British and American screen adaptations of selected nineteenth century women’s novels.
As the contemporary popular culture is increasingly reliant on adaptation and other derivative types of cultural texts such as sequels, retellings, and pastiche, it becomes vital to study the continued appeal of canonical literature.
